Buying Guide: What to Look for in a Gaming Desk with Cable Management
Choosing the right cable management solution for your gaming desk means balancing desk design, organization capacity, and ease of setup. Here are the key criteria we evaluated for every product in this review.
Desk Size and Surface Area
A spacious desktop lets you spread out multiple monitors, a tower, and peripherals without feeling cramped. Desks between 55 and 60 inches wide offer plenty of room for a dual-monitor battlestation. Cable Management Integration
Look for built-in cable trays, grommets, or flip-top panels that hide cords without extra purchases. Some desks come with a dedicated power strip holder or fabric netting underneath. For existing desks, add-on trays like the Scanfield or Cotohim models provide a no-drill solution. Integrated systems keep your setup cleaner from day one.
Build Quality and Stability
A wobbly desk ruins the gaming experience. Steel frames and reinforced support beams prevent monitor shake during intense gameplay. Dual-beam designs with four support rods, as seen in the DeskShow electric standing desk, keep your monitors steady even at full height. Always check weight capacity, especially if you run a gaming desk for multiple PCs.
Ease of Installation and Adjustability
No one wants to spend hours assembling their desk. Look for simple instructions, pre-drilled holes, and tool-free mounts. Height-adjustable desks add flexibility for sitting and standing, but also check how cable management adapts to movement. For a quick upgrade, adhesive cable trays or clamp-on organizers install in minutes without drilling.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the easiest way to manage cables on a gaming desk?
Start with a simple under-desk cable tray that attaches with adhesive or clamps. The Scanfield tray requires no tools and holds power strips and adapters securely. Combine it with cable ties and clips for individual wires.
Do gaming desks with built-in cable management cost more?
Not necessarily. While premium electric standing desks like the DeskShow model include advanced cable routing, many fixed desks like the HLDIRECT 55 Inch Gaming Desk come with grommets and a monitor stand at a budget-friendly price. Add-on trays are also inexpensive.
Can I use cable management trays on a standing desk?
Yes, most fabric or plastic trays work well on height-adjustable desks. Just ensure the tray attaches securely to the frame and has enough slack in the cables to accommodate the full range of motion. The Cotohim tray with clamp or screw mounts stays put during adjustments.
How do I hide cables for a cleaner streaming setup in 2026?
Use a combined approach: a desk with a built-in cable tray for the main power strip, plus adhesive clips along the legs to route monitor and webcam wires.
